As market demand grows for high-performance materials, coil coating aluminium has established itself as an essential manufacturing process. This technique involves the continuous application of a protective and decorative finish to aluminium coils before they are formed into end products. The efficiency of this process fits well into today's fast-paced production environments, allowing manufacturers to achieve consistent quality while reducing wastage.

One of the core features of coil coating aluminium is its versatility. The process utilizes advanced technology to apply a variety of coatings, including polyester, polyurethane, and PVDF (polyvinylidene fluoride), each tailored for specific environmental conditions and performance needs. Essentially, manufacturers can achieve remarkable customization in colors, textures, and finishes.

Moreover, coil-coated aluminium boasts impressive durability, corrosion resistance, and UV stability. These attributes make it especially appealing in sectors such as construction, automotive, and appliance manufacturing. The controlled environment of the coil coating process ensures that each layer adheres perfectly, which results in an end product that can withstand harsh weather conditions and exposure to chemicals without degradation.

When discussing advantages, one cannot overlook the significant sustainability aspect of coil coating aluminium. The process generates minimal waste during production, and the coatings used are typically free from harmful solvents, aligning with environmental standards. Furthermore, the ability to recycle aluminium means that products can maintain a lower carbon footprint over their lifecycle.
